Abstract
The FAA proposes to adopt a new airworthiness directive (AD) for all Daher Aerospace (type certificate previously held by SOCATA) Models TB 20 and TB 21 airplanes. This AD was prompted by mandatory continuing airworthiness information (MCAI) originated by an aviation authority of another country to identify and correct an unsafe condition on an aviation product. The MCAI describes the unsafe condition as cracks on the main landing gear (MLG) legs. This proposed AD would require repetitively inspecting the MLG and performing all applicable corrective actions. The FAA is proposing this AD to address the unsafe condition on these products.

Background
The European Union Aviation Safety Agency (EASA), which is the
Technical Agent for the Member States of the European Union, has issued
EASA AD 2019-0274, dated November 6, 2019 (referred to after this as
``the MCAI''), to address an unsafe condition on all Daher Aerospace
(formerly SOCATA) Models TB 20 and TB 21 airplanes. The MCAI states:
Occurrences have been reported of finding cracks on MLG legs of
TB 20 and TB 21 aeroplanes.
This condition, if not detected and corrected, could lead to
structural failure of an MLG leg and consequent MLG collapse,
possibly resulting in damage to the aeroplane and injury to
occupants.
[[Page 51841]]
To address this potential unsafe condition, DAHER Aerospace
issued the [service bulletin] SB to provide inspection instructions.
For the reasons described above, this [EASA] AD requires
repetitive special detailed inspections (SDI) using magnetic
particle method of the affected MLG area, and, depending on
findings, accomplishment of applicable corrective action(s).

Costs of Compliance
The FAA estimates that this AD, if adopted as proposed, would
affect 52 airplanes of U.S. registry. The FAA also estimates that it
would take about 8 work-hours per airplane to perform the magnetic
particle inspection that would be required by this proposed AD. The
average labor rate is $85 per work-hour.
Based on these figures, the FAA estimates the inspection cost of
this proposed AD on U.S. operators to be $35,360, or $680 per airplane,
per inspection cycle.
In addition, the FAA estimates that any necessary rework would take
12 work-hours and require parts costing $400, for a cost of $1,420 per
airplane. The FAA has no way of determining the number of airplanes
that may need these actions. If the reworked MLG area is found damaged
during a follow-on magnetic particle inspection, because the damage may
vary considerably from airplane to airplane, the FAA has no way of
estimating this repair cost.

(g) Repetitive Inspections
(1) Before the MLG exceeds 16,000 landings since first
installation on an airplane or within 200 landings after the
effective date of this AD, whichever occurs later, and thereafter at
intervals not to exceed 3,200 landings, accomplish the magnetic
particle inspection on each MLG for cracks in the left-hand and
right-hand MLG leg and take all applicable corrective actions before
further flight in accordance with the Description of Accomplishment
Instructions in Daher Service Bulletin SB 10-154-32, dated September
2019, except you are not required to contact the manufacturer.
Instead, repair using a method approved by the Manager,
International Validation Branch, FAA; the European Union Aviation
Safety Agency (EASA); or Daher Aerospace's EASA Design Organization
Approval (DOA). If approved by the DOA, the approval must include
the DOA-authorized signature. For a
[[Page 51842]]
repair to be approved as required by this paragraph, the approval
letter must specifically refer to this AD.
(2) For the purposes of this AD, any maneuver resulting in
weight on the MLG for any duration of time after initial takeoff
counts as a landing. If the number of landings for the MLG is
unknown, multiply the number of airframe hours by a factor of 3.6
and round up to the nearest whole landing.
